Title: Building My Portfolio Website with Modern Technologies
Overview: This project description explores the development of my portfolio website, developershihab.com, leveraging modern and cutting-edge technologies to showcase my skills and projects. The website, built using React.js, TypeScript, Next.js, Tailwind CSS, and Framer Motion, serves as a showcase of my expertise in web development.
Project Details:
-
Objective: The primary goal was to create a visually appealing and interactive portfolio website that highlights my skills, projects, and experience. Leveraging modern technologies, the website aimed to demonstrate my portfolio and experienc to the world
-
Technologies Used:
- React.js: A popular JavaScript library for building user interfaces.
- TypeScript: A statically typed superset of JavaScript, enhancing code quality and maintainability.
- Next.js: A React framework for building server-side rendered and statically generated web applications.
- Tailwind CSS: A utility-first CSS framework for rapidly building custom designs.
- Framer Motion: A library for creating fluid animations and interactions in React applications.
-
Features:
- Responsive Design: The website features a responsive design, ensuring optimal viewing experience across devices and screen sizes.
- Dynamic Content: Utilizing Next.js, the website dynamically renders content, providing fast page loads and smooth navigation.
- Custom Design: Tailwind CSS was employed to create a custom design system, resulting in a unique and visually appealing website.
- Interactive Elements: Framer Motion was used to incorporate interactive elements and animations, enhancing user engagement and visual appeal.
- Project Showcase: The portfolio showcases my projects, skills, blogs and experience, allowing visitors to explore my work in detail.
- Source Code & Live Link: The source code is available on GitHub for reference and contribution, while the live website allows visitors to view and interact with the portfolio.
-
Implementation Challenges: Integrating various technologies and ensuring seamless functionality posed challenges during development. Fine-tuning animations and optimizing performance were particularly demanding tasks.
-
Results & Impact: The portfolio website successfully achieved its objectives, providing a visually stunning showcase of my skills and projects. It serves as a testament to my expertise in web development, attracting potential clients and employers.
-
Future Enhancements:
- Continuously updating and adding new projects to keep the portfolio relevant and up-to-date.
- Implementing additional features such as a blog section or contact form to enhance user engagement.
- Further optimizing performance and accessibility to ensure the website remains fast and accessible to all users.
Conclusion: Developing my portfolio website with modern technologies has allowed me to showcase my skills and projects in a visually appealing and interactive manner. By leveraging React.js, TypeScript, Next.js, Tailwind CSS, and Framer Motion, I have created a dynamic and engaging platform that highlights my expertise in web application development. The portfolio serves as a valuable tool for attracting clients and opportunities while demonstrating my commitment to staying at the forefront of technology in the field of softeware development.